The Monticello Climate: What Homeowners Need to Know
Monticello experiences all four seasons vividly. Summers can be hot and humid, with temperatures often climbing into the 80s and 90s, and occasional thunderstorms. Winters are cold, frequently dipping below freezing, with snow and ice that demand winterizing efforts. Spring and fall bring fluctuating temperatures and seasonal storms, including high winds that can threaten roofs, trees, and fences.
This climate means homeowners need to stay on top of seasonal maintenance:
- Winterizing: Insulating pipes, sealing drafts, and preparing heating systems for the cold months.
- Spring & Fall Repairs: Clearing gutters, inspecting roofs for damage from winter storms, and addressing any cracks or shifting foundations caused by freeze-thaw cycles.
- Summer Prep: Maintaining decks, sealing concrete, and checking air conditioning systems to stay cool during those humid months.
Common Home Maintenance Challenges in Monticello
Because of our lakeside location and variable weather, Monticello homeowners often face specific issues:
- Roof Damage & Leaks: High winds and hail can damage shingles, especially on older homes. Regular inspections help prevent leaks and water damage.
- Foundation & Basement Concerns: The freeze-thaw cycle can cause shifting or cracking, especially in homes built on expansive clay soil common in Indiana.
- Gutter & Drainage Problems: Heavy rains and leaf buildup can clog gutters, leading to water pooling and potential water intrusion.
- Deck & Dock Maintenance: Wooden decks and lakeside docks are exposed to moisture and sun, requiring periodic sealing, staining, or repairs.
- HVAC & Insulation Needs: To stay comfortable year-round, efficient heating and cooling systems are essential, especially in older homes with less insulation.
Popular Home Styles & Their Unique Needs
Monticello's diverse architecture influences the types of repairs and upgrades needed:
- Victorian & Historic Homes: These require gentle restoration work, like lead paint removal, window restoration, and masonry repairs to preserve their charm.
- Lakeside Cottages: Often built with wood siding, these homes need frequent sealing and painting to withstand moisture and sun exposure.
- New Construction Homes: Typically more energy-efficient, but may still need upgrades such as smart HVAC systems, landscaping, or deck additions.
